Kinds Of UK Driving Licenses
The uk license uses various categories of driving licenses based on the type of vehicle that people wish to run. Comprehending these classifications is crucial for both new drivers and those seeking to upgrade their existing licenses. The main types include:

Full Driving License: This is the most typical type of license, allowing individuals to drive cars and other automobile.

Provisionary Driving License: This is issued to new drivers license uk who have actually applied to take their driving test. It allows students to drive under certain conditions (e.g., accompanied by a qualified driver) while they prepare for their driving test.

Motorbike License: This enables people to run motorcycles. The bike license can even more be partitioned into:
AM: Moped licenseA1: Light motorbike licenseA2: Medium motorbike licenseA: Full motorcycle license for larger bikes
Commercial Driving License: For those who plan to drive industrial lorries, such as buses or heavy items vehicles (HGVs). These licenses need extra endorsements and Buy driving license training.

Driving License for Special Vehicles: This includes licenses for particular automobile types like tractors or specific types of agricultural equipment.

Applicants should state if they struggle with any medical conditions that may impact their ability to drive. Some conditions require a medical checkup or alert to the Driver and Vehicle Licensing Agency (DVLA).
4. Passing the Theory Test
Before obtaining a useful driving test, candidates should pass a theory test. This test assesses understanding of the Highway Code, roadway indications, and safe driving practices. It includes:
A multiple-choice sectionA risk perception test5. Practical Driving Test
Once the theory test is passed, candidates can reserve a practical driving test. This evaluation evaluates an individual's driving abilities behind the wheel and guarantees they can run a car safely in different conditions.

Can I drive in other nations with a UK driving license?
Yes, a UK driving license is typically acknowledged in many nations worldwide. However, it is a good idea to inspect the requirements for the particular country, as some may require an International Driving Permit (IDP) in addition to the UK license.
4. What should I do if I lose my driving license?
If a driving license is lost, the individual must report it to the DVLA as soon as possible and apply for a replacement license online or by submitting a paper form. This usually needs a charge.
5. Can I drive if I have a medical condition?
Numerous medical conditions can affect a person's capability to drive. It is essential to inform the DVLA about any diagnosis that may hinder safe driving. The DVLA will examine each case on a specific basis, and driving may be restricted or temporarily prohibited till medical physical fitness is validated.
